About 45 All Hallows Road
45 All Hallows Road is a three-bedroom detached house in Walkington, Beverley, Beverley (HU17 8SH). It has a recorded floor area of 102 m² (around 1098 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2022)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in June 2012 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81).
Most recent transfer was April 2025 at £278,775 — fresh data.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 81% of similar EPCs). Across 2001–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£329,000 is 18% above the 2025 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£254/sq ft) was about 47.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
